3

ですから、私にはかなり複雑な問題があると思います。数画面の長さのこの巨大なTextViewがあります。私がやりたいのは、TextViewを小さなTextViewに分割し、それぞれが表示されている画面の高さ(つまり、垂直スクロールなし)で、小さなTextViewを水平スクロールギャラリーに配置することです。後者は問題なく実行できますが、TextViewを分割する良い方法は考えられません。

また、TextViewには、さまざまなスタイルのテキスト(さまざまなサイズ、間隔など)が含まれていることにも注意してください。

私は必ずしも解決策を探しているわけではありませんが、提案は役に立ち、ありがたいです。

4

1 に答える 1

2

AndroViewsまたはandroid-viewflowを確認する必要があります。それらはあなたが話している水平ページングを提供し、android-viewflowはアダプターによって支えられています。

TextViewを分割するという点では、をサブクラス化して、onMeasure()そこでサイズを計算し始めることができます。FBReaderがあなたが話していることをほぼ正確に実行するので、FBReaderがそれをどのように実行するかを調べることもできます。

于 2011-06-07T20:15:16.923 に答える